Transaction 5904e45470fea76bb1ec62d4052b89a42dfc50b91da2b57b27f9635dc577ed20
1 Input
2 Outputs
- 5904e45470fea76bb1ec62d4052b89a42dfc50b91da2b57b27f9635dc577ed20:0
- 5904e45470fea76bb1ec62d4052b89a42dfc50b91da2b57b27f9635dc577ed20:1
value 310274
address 1AX2WHW8YWAYcLuCNnxJY6oVVntWQxN39N
value 5700621809
address 1Hu8C8q5HrwbWcgJ8LfK8quSTLH4aL6gPA